915 Broadway, application for a window master plan.

At the regularly scheduled monthly Community Board Five meeting on Thursday, July 09, 2020, the following resolution passed with a vote of 42 in favor; 0 opposed; 1 abstaining:

WHEREAS, 915 Broadway is a 20 story office/loft building at at the Southwest corner of Broadway and East 21st  Street with 72 feet of frontage on Broadway and 128 feet of frontage on East 21st Street and is located in the Ladies’ Mile Historic District; and

WHEREAS, The building clad with limestone and brick, was constructed between 1925 and 1926 to a design by Joseph Martine; and

WHEREAS, At the time of designation (1989), the building contained above the third floor non-original one-over-one double-hung metal sashed windows with a few three-over-three original wood-framed double-hung windows; and

WHEREAS, The owners propose to replace all windows with energy efficient one-over-one aluminum-framed double-hung windows framed to match existing window dimensions; and  

WHEREAS, The owners have submitted a Master Plan for replacing all windows above the third floor in the building without a defined schedule for completion of the project, with plans that window replacement will be done on a tenant-by-tenant basis upon the vacancy of occupied space; and

WHEREAS, The building contains a small number of wood-framed three-over-three double-hung original fabric windows; and

RESOLVED, Community Board Five recommends approval of the application by 915 Broadway for approval of a Master Plan for window replacement and, furthermore, recommends that existing original windows in usable or repairable condition be preserved and reused in-situ or at an alternate location on the building.
